UND Aerospace operates one of the largest, most advanced fleets of training aircraft in the world. With over 120 aircraft system wide, UND trains more than 1000 pilots each year.

UND’s fleet consists of glass cockpit equipped Cessna, Piper and Beech fixed wing aircraft, as well as Bell and Schweizer helicopters. At Grand Forks International Airport, UND operates over 130 aircraft. UND operates the same types of aircraft at its satellite campuses in Phoenix, AZ, Spokane, WA, and Crookston, MN.

Job Placement

UND aviation students are required to meet stringent standards set by the FAA and the UND Aerospace program. UND Aerospace has relationships with nearly all US airlines to provide job placement for its graduates. Aerospace Student Services specializes in placing recent graduates into internship and flight positions.
